Airbag recall completed by Lexus Teesside, they also replaced the dashboard clips after I mentioned I was relying on felt pads stuffed between the dash and windscreen to stop it rattling. Drove it last night on an 80 mile round trip and all seems well, no rattles from the dash at all - so very pleased.

Got a CT200h as a loan for the day, which seems standard for the recall, and when I collected my car I had been given a free valet (on the invoice) and I also got fuel (not on invoice) - went in with about a 1/4 tank and it had just over 1/2 a tank on pickup - so it's funny how some are getting fuel while others don't?

However, the health check condemned my rear tyres - tread was OK but they were showing some cuts and cracks and they've also diagnosed a stuck rear brake caliper. They were suprisingly competitive with the tyre quote so got those sorted but I'm going to get a second opinion on the caliper issue.
